Two-photon induced photodecarbonylation reaction of cyclopropenones
Nurtay K Urdabayev1, Andrei Poloukhtine, Vladimir V Popik
1Center for Photochemical Sciences, Bowling Green State University, Ohio 43403, USA.
Abstract:
Irradiation of cyclopropenones (1a-c) with 800 nm pulses of ultrafast laser results in a photodecarbonylation reaction via nonresonant two-photon absorption of light.
